The state health department has launched a new webpage to explain the federal work requirement for some Medicaid recipients that will take effect in 2027.

The Wisconsin Department of Health Services is still reviewing the federal rule, released on June 1, governing how states are to implement the work requirements, a spokesperson said. Medicaid is known as BadgerCare in Wisconsin.
